Soft, bendy sourdough crackers are the single most common complaint I hear, and I made every one of these mistakes myself before I figured them out. Over 11 years of baking — and three years selling crackers out of a home microbakery where a soft batch meant a batch I couldn’t sell — I learned exactly what separates a cracker that shatters from one that just bends. Here’s the full diagnosis.
1. You Rolled the Dough Too Thick
This is the cause about 70 percent of the time. A cracker is thin by definition. If your dough is thicker than about 2 millimeters, the inside cannot dry out before the outside burns, so you get a chewy, bready center no matter how long you bake.
The fix: roll thinner than feels reasonable. You should be able to almost see the parchment through the dough. If you struggle to roll it that thin, your dough probably needs a longer rest so the gluten relaxes — let it sit 30 to 60 minutes before rolling.
2. You Underbaked Them
Crispness comes from moisture leaving the dough. If you pull crackers while they’re still pale, there’s still water inside, and they will be soft even after cooling. Bake until they are evenly, fully golden — not blond, not pale at the center. Color is your doneness signal.
Thin edges brown before thick centers, so on most batches I pull the finished outer crackers off the sheet and return the middle ones for another 3 to 5 minutes. Uneven thickness means uneven doneness.
3. You Judged Them Straight Out of the Oven
Crackers do not reach full crispness until they cool. Straight off the sheet they’re hot and still a little pliable; as they cool, the starches set and they crisp up. Always judge a cracker at room temperature. If a fully cooled cracker still bends instead of snapping, then it genuinely needs more time — go back to reasons 1 and 2.
4. Your Dough Was Too Wet
Higher-hydration discard makes a stickier dough that’s hard to roll thin and holds more water to bake off. If your dough feels tacky and slack, work in more flour until it’s a firm, smooth, pasta-like dough. A stiffer dough rolls thinner and crisps more reliably.
5. You Skipped Docking
Docking — pricking the rolled dough all over with a fork — lets steam escape during baking. Undocked dough traps steam and puffs into little pillows that stay soft inside. Dock generously across the whole sheet before baking. It takes 20 seconds and makes a real difference.
6. Your Oven Runs Cool
Many home ovens run 15 to 25 degrees below their dial. If your crackers consistently take much longer than the recipe says and never quite crisp, an inexpensive oven thermometer will tell you the truth. I bake crackers at a true 350°F; if your oven runs cool, you’re really baking at 325°F and wondering why nothing crisps.
7. You Stored Them Wrong (or Your Kitchen Is Humid)
Even perfect crackers go soft if they cool in a humid kitchen or get sealed up while still slightly warm. Always cool crackers completely on a rack before storing, and store them in a truly airtight container. Trapped residual warmth creates condensation, and condensation is the enemy of crisp.
The 5-Minute Rescue for Soft Crackers
If you’ve got a batch that came out soft, or crackers that softened in storage, you can almost always save them. Spread them in a single layer on a baking sheet and put them in a 300°F (150°C) oven for 5 to 8 minutes, then cool completely. This drives off the residual moisture. I’ve revived crackers that were a week old and gone limp, and they came back perfectly snappy.
My Crisp-Cracker Checklist
- Roll to 1–2mm — thin enough to almost see through
- Dock the whole surface with a fork
- Bake to fully, evenly golden (not pale)
- Pull finished edge pieces early; finish the centers
- Cool completely before judging or storing
- Store airtight; re-crisp at 300°F if needed

Crisp Is a Technique, Not Luck
Once you internalize that crispness is just moisture leaving thin dough, the whole thing demystifies. Roll thin, dock, bake to color, cool fully. Get those four right and you will never bake a soft cracker again — and the ones that do slip through, you now know how to rescue.
